Expanding Research on Delta 9 THC
One of the most exciting developments in the future of Delta 9 THC is the increase in research into its potential health benefits. While Delta 9 has been studied more extensively than many other cannabinoids, there is still much to learn—especially about how low doses of hemp-derived Delta 9 can impact health and wellness. Preliminary findings and anecdotal evidence suggest Delta 9 may help with:
- Stress and anxiety reduction
- Appetite stimulation
- Pain relief
- Enhanced mood
As regulations evolve and more clinical studies are conducted, we expect a deeper understanding of how Delta 9 works with the body’s endocannabinoid system and how it can be used safely and effectively for specific conditions.
Growth of the Hemp-Derived Delta 9 Market
With the 2018 Farm Bill legalizing hemp-derived cannabinoids (as long as Delta 9 content is no more than 0.3% by dry weight), the market for Delta 9 THC has rapidly expanded. What once was only available through dispensaries in legalized states is now accessible in innovative forms—like Delta 9 THC seltzers, gummies, tinctures, and more. Consumers now have more choices than ever, and brands are stepping up with high-quality, lab-tested products that deliver euphoric effects without compromising on safety or compliance.
